Research on Quantitative Taxonomy of Cultivars in Pingyin Rose

Abstract: Cluster analysis was applied to classify cultivars of Pingyin rose. Selected 37 characters of 21 cultivars were investigated. All selected cultivars were grouped by running SAS cluster program. The results showed: the cultivars can be grouped into three clusters by Q cluster analysis at level of Lq1 = 1.2586 and five clusters at the level of Lq2 = 1.128. The‘meigui’type is closer to the‘qiangwei’type in the affinity relationship than others.

Key words: Rose, Pingyin rose, Quantitative classification, Cluster analysis
